Close the gap between SIEM and SAP

SAP systems are at the heart of IT in most companies. Permanent monitoring of transactions and applications as protection is therefore essential.

Monitoring the current risk and compliance status and rapid analyses increase the security of sensitive data and ensure compliance with all legal obligations.

Many companies often use so-called SIEM solutions to monitor and evaluate information.

However, there is a gap when it comes to monitoring SAP systems. This is because SAP systems are a blind spot for SIEM tools, as they have no special SAP check rules. Threats and attacks are therefore usually not identified due to a lack of attack patterns.

This is where the SAST SUITE security radar comes into play, which is not limited to a key date-related analysis of authorizations and system configuration, but also carries out vulnerability scans of all technology levels in real time.

And integration with a comprehensive SIEM tool allows managers to consolidate all security incidents in their SAP systems with other relevant IT systems. Critical incidents are thus uncovered and countermeasures can be taken immediately.
